Advanced Diagnostic Equipment Deployment

Our technicians utilize a range of specialized tools. This includes thermal imaging cameras that detect temperature differences caused by moisture, acoustic sensors that listen for the sound of escaping water, and moisture meters that measure water content in building materials. This non-invasive technology is key to pinpointing leaks without tearing into walls.

Warning Signs You Need Leak Detection Services

Catching leaks early is critical. These subtle indicators can save you from significant water damage and costly repairs. Ignoring these signs means the problem is likely growing, potentially impacting your home’s structure and your family’s health. Be aware of what to look for around your property.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p or musty smell, especially in basements, bathrooms, or closets, often indicates hidden mold growth fueled by a slow water leak. This smell can be a strong indicator of trouble brewing unseen.

Unexplained High Water Bills

If your water bill suddenly spikes without a change in your water usage habits, it’s a clear sign of a leak. This unexpected expense is your water meter telling you something is wrong.

Water Stains or Discoloration

Look for brown or yellow stains on ceilings, walls, or floors. These marks are often the first visible evidence of water seeping through materials from above or behind.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per

Moisture trapped behind paint or wallpaper can cause it to blister, peel, or bubble. This is a direct result of water saturation weakening the adhesive and the surface.

Cracked or Warped Flooring

Wood floors can warp, and tiles can loosen or grout can crumble if there’s constant moisture underneath or around them. This indicates subsurface water damage.

Mold or Mildew Growth

Any visible mold or mildew, especially in damp areas, is a strong indicator that there’s an ongoing moisture problem, likely from an undetected leak. This is a health concern as well as a structural one.

Leak Detection Services v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Visible drip from a pipe under a sink Yes No Easy to see and often a simple fix like tightening a fitting.
Suspected leak behind a wall or under a foundation No Yes Requires specialized equipment and expertise to locate without causing further damage.
High water bill with no obvious cause No Yes A professional can use acoustic sensors and thermal imaging to find hidden leaks.
Mold growth in a bathroom or basement Maybe (for surface mold) Yes (for source) Surface mold can be cleaned, but the underlying leak needs professional detection to prevent recurrence.
Leaky appliance hose (e.g., dishwasher, washing machine) Yes No These are typically visible and have straightforward repair or replacement steps.
Persistent dampness or musty odors No Yes These signs often point to unseen moisture issues that need professional diagnostic tools.

While some minor leaks are easy to spot and fix yourself, many situations require professional intervention. When you’re dealing with hidden moisture, potential structural damage, or a leak that’s impacting your insurance claim, calling a pro is the smartest move. Leak Detection Services Cost In Elk River, MN

The cost of leak detection services in Elk River, MN can vary based on several factors. These include the complexity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and the accessibility of the suspected leak source. These figures are general estimates and a precise quote requires an on-site assessment.

Service Aspect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Leak Detection Inspection $300 – $800 Time spent, complexity of the property layout.
Acoustic Leak Detection $500 – $1,500 Difficulty in hearing the leak, ambient noise levels.
Thermal Imaging Scan $600 – $1,800 Size of the area to scan, accessibility of walls/ceilings.
Moisture Meter Readings & Analysis $250 – $700 Number of readings, depth of material being tested.
Detailed Damage Report for Insurance $200 – $500 Thoroughness of documentation, number of affected areas.
Emergency Leak Detection Call-Out +$200-$500 (on top of inspection) After-hours or weekend service calls.

Will leak detection damage my home?

Our primary goal is to use non-invasive methods whenever possible. Techniques like thermal imaging and acoustic listening allow us to pinpoint leaks without tearing into walls or floors unnecessarily. We only resort to minor exploratory openings if absolutely required, and these are typically small and easy to repair. We prioritize preserving your home’s integrity.
